This is a service / maintenance or supply contract in Cleveland, Ohio. Contact the soliciting agency for additional information.
The work to be performed under the contract is subject to the requirements of Section 3 of the Housing and Urban Development Act of 1968, as amended. CMHA is a Political Subdivision of the State of Ohio and is exempt from all taxes. The scope of services to be provided by the design and consulting firm may be summarized as follows: 1. The selected firm(s) shall coordinate with CMHA and its affiliates in providing services contained in this RFQ and HUD Form 51915. 2. Visit the site as necessary to gather information, verify existing conditions and work requirements, and provide CMHA with a budget and a plan to meet the goal of the project. Selective demolition to be provided by firm as necessary upon agreement with CMHA. 3. Provide a schedule detailing scope development, design, bid documents, construction duration, etc. to describe the thorough completion of the project. 4. Develop the basic design and provide all drawings and technical specifications to CMHA staff. Discuss appropriate options or alternatives to the basic design that was established. 5. Provide interim submittal documents for review by CMHA at mutually agreed upon intervals throughout the design and documentation phases. Each submittal shall include an updated statement of probable construction costs to the level of detail appropriate and agreed upon during the time of contract negotiations. Upon each submittal, the design schedule shall be reviewed to determine if the firm is meeting its obligations as proposed. 6. Assist CMHA and its affiliates with the bidding process. Once bids are received, they will assist CMHA by reviewing the bids for both cost and responsiveness and recommendation of winning bidder. 7. Attend and lead a preconstruction meeting and make site observation visits as negotiated. 8. Develop weekly project meeting agendas, write and distribute project meeting minutes, weekly field reports, receive and respond to submittals & RFI's, prepare and issue bulletins as necessary, review change order proposals and recommend acceptance as necessary, 9. Develop project record documents electronically. 10. Provide warranty phase services as agreed upon during contract negotiations. Term: CMHA intends to enter into a three-year contract with the successful firm(s) selected to provide the services Indefinite Quantities Contract (IQC): CMHA does not guarantee any minimum or maximum amount of work as a result of any award ensuing from this RFQ, but will reserve the right to award work on an as-needed basis. CMHA is committed to involving Minority and Women-owned businesses in its procurements and awarded contracts. Any MBE or WBE qualified vendor should state specifically such status. CMHA has established the following goals with regards to Minority and Women Owned Businesses. Bidders are required to make sincere efforts in attempting to achieve CMHA participation goals. In the event subcontracting goals are not met, bidders shall submit documentation showing good faith efforts in attempting to achieve applicable goals. Minority-Owned Business goal: 20% of contract dollars Woman-Owned Business goal: 10% of contract dollars. MBE/WBE Program Coordinators are central points of contact for MBE/WBE Program compliance by CMHA and its contractors and subcontractors.
